GRILLED HALIBUT RECIPE | ALLRECIPES



Grilled Halibut Recipe | Allrecipes image

This is delicious, and I have made it many times since. We have used many types of fish as well as halibut, which I prefer.

Provided by braniffb13

Categories     Main Dishes    Seafood Main Dishes    Halibut

Total Time 20 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Cook Time 10 minutes

Yield 4 halibut steaks

Number Of Ingredients 9

¾ cup butter, softened
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1?½ teaspoons onion powder
1?½ teaspoons dried parsley
¾ teaspoon dried dill weed
¼ teaspoon white sugar
¼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
4 inch-thick halibut steaks

Steps:

  • Preheat grill for medium heat and lightly oil the grate.
  • Stir butter, lemon juice, onion powder, parsley, dill, sugar, salt, and pepper together in a bowl; spread evenly over the halibut steaks.
  • Cook on preheated grill until the fish flakes easily with a fork, 5 to 6 minutes per side.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 498.3 calories, CarbohydrateContent 1.5 g, CholesterolContent 153.9 mg, FatContent 37.7 g, FiberContent 0.2 g, ProteinContent 36.4 g, SaturatedFatContent 21.9 g, SodiumContent 485.8 mg, SugarContent 0.7 g

GRILLED HALIBUT SIMPLY DELICIOUS R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Grilled Halibut Simply Delicious Recipe - Food.com image

This is a Greek version of grilled halibut. Yes I know halibut is not Greek but it's the flavors and simplicity of cooking that is Greek. Flavored with olive oil, lemon, garlic and Greek oregano. You can use halibut steak which can handle the grill better.

Total Time 25 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 10 minutes

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 1/2 lbs halibut fillets
1/4 cup olive oil
3 garlic cloves, minced
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 tablespoons fresh parsley
2 teaspoons fresh Greek oregano
1/2 teaspoon salt (optional)
1 teaspoon black pepper

Steps:

  • Combine olive oil, garlic, lemon juice, parsley, oregano, salt and pepper in a zip lock bag. Mix the marinade and add halibut and refrigerate for 1 hour. Preheat grill.
  • Remove halibut from bag and place on hot very WELL OILED grill.
  • Grill for 4 to 5 minutes per side.
  • Place fish and don`t move for 4 minutes or it will fall apart.
  • Fish is done when it flakes easily with a fork and is opaque all the way through.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 317.9, FatContent 16.3, SaturatedFatContent 2.5, CholesterolContent 102.2, SodiumContent 141.7, CarbohydrateContent 2.4, FiberContent 0.7, SugarContent 0.3, ProteinContent 38.7

HOW TO GRILL WILD HALIBUT | WILD ALASKAN COMPANY
Jun 20, 2018 · Generally, an inch-thick halibut steak or fillet will grill to perfection in about 10 minutes over medium-high heat while thinner cuts can cook in as little time as 5-7 minutes. There are a few ways to know when your fish is ready to take off the grill. Halibut is good to go when the meat is opaque through the middle and flakes easily with a fork.

TIPS FOR GRILLING HALIBUT
Sep 17, 2020 · Grilling Time and Doneness. Because this fish will dry out easily, the grilling time on halibut is pretty short. So make sure to keep a close eye on it to avoid overcooking. A 1-inch halibut steak will grill up in about 10 minutes over medium-high heat while thinner cuts and fillets can cook in as little time as 6 minutes.

THERMAL SECRETS: HOW TO GRILL HALIBUT | THERMOWORKS
For a firm-but-flaky fish, shoot for a perfect medium (130 to 135°F). The center will be opaque, but not glossy or pink. If a rare, or medium-rare is more to your liking, look for temperatures around 120°F for rare and 125°F medium rare.

COOKING HALIBUT | 5 SURE FIRE WAYS ON HOW TO COOK HALIBUT
You want the fish to have an internal temperature of 145 degrees. How to Cook Halibut Grilling Halibut The low oil content will make it stick to the grill so make sure you start with a clean grill grate and make sure to oil your grate before you start cooking. Apply a generous amount of olive oil, butter or marinade to your steak or fillet.
